Abstract
Extensive effort has been put into improved understanding of avalanche deflection over the last two years. This paper discusses construction of defelcting dams in steep terrain, and gives an in-depth description of the recent design of two deflecting dams in western Norway. The design is based on a computational/empirical approach convenient for practitioners. Trajectories and preliminary run-up heights on the defelcting dam are first calculated using a centre-of-mass model based on the Voellmy-Perla equation. To compensate for thel imitations of a centre-of-mass consideration, the run-up heights are subsequently calibrated utilising observations of six full-scale avalanches in terrain formations acting as "natural defelcting dams". The functionality of the two dams is demonstrated by comparisons between the design criteria and the observations of four major avalanches impacting the two dams shortly after completion. The validity of the method is further demonstrated by comparison of calculated and observed run-up heights for avalanches impacting the deflection dam in Flateyri, Iceland. The observations on the constructed dams are finally used to update the calibaration procedure.
